Ответы пользователя по тегу Docker
  • Не получается создать Docker image через docker-compose c кодом на GO?

    @micronull
    Вы пытаетесь запустить через `go run`.
    Эта команда компилирует приложение во временную директорию и от туда его запускает.
    В итоге контейнер после успешной компиляции завершает своё выполнение и ни как не реагирует на запуск временного файла.

    Вы можете через multi-stage builds предварительно скомпилировать приложение и переместить полученный файл в новый image.
    И уже там прописывать ENTRYPOINT на полученный бинарный файл.
    Ответ написан
    5 комментариев
  • Локальная разработка и Docker?

    @micronull
    Я использую для локальной разработки docker. Это значительно удобнее, чем держать полноценное окружение из зоопарка разных версий php и прочих штук.
    Если сайт старый, под какие-нибудь древние версии apache, php и mysql. Не проблема, - смотрю на hub, если нет, то собираю свой.
    При этом спокойно можно переключить на другой проект, более современный. Например с nginx, php7 и postgresql. Предварительно выключив предыдущий контейнер.

    Далее в перспективе можно спокойно кинуть контейнер на сервер и за пару минут развернуть сервис.

    В общем настоятельно рекомендую попробовать docker при локальной разработке.
    Ответ написан
    9 комментариев